Research Experience
  • In the Computational Materials Research Laboratory (CMRL), the team focuses on discovering new materials for a wide range of applications and uncovering the underlying mechanisms behind many materials-related phenomena.
Background
  • Research interests include the physical and mechanical properties of materials and related phenomena. Through numerical simulation tools, we explore interactions at the electronic and atomic levels to develop innovative theoretical and computational frameworks that connect microscopic and macroscopic material characteristics.
